About the Company: 

WELL EMR Group is currently in need of a Technical Support Analyst to join their rapidly expanding operations team in the Whitby, On and Vancouver, BC office. This is a permanent role in the medical IT industry.  

The role is going to be mostly "Work from Home" and post COVID there may be occasional in office meetings so proximity to the offices is preferred in both Ontario and BC.  

WELL EMR Group is the third largest Electronic Medical Record vendor in Canada, and rapidly expanding. The company offers several products and the support position will be for the OSCAR Professional EMR software. WELL EMR Group is a wholly owned subsidiary of WELL Health Technology (WELL.TO), a publicly traded technology company based in Vancouver.  

WELL Health Technologies is a leading multifaceted healthcare organization that offers both clinical care and technology services.
